Anegundi

Anegundi is a small village located just 5 km from Hampi and is believed to be the birthplace of Lord Hanuman. This ancient village is steeped in mythology and history, with several temples and ancient structures worth visiting.

  • The Anjanadri Hill, which is said to be the birthplace of Lord Hanuman, offers stunning views of the surrounding landscape.
  • The Anegundi Temple, dedicated to Lord Hanuman, is a beautiful example of ancient Indian architecture.
  • The Pampa Sarovar, a sacred lake, is a popular spot for picnics and relaxation.

Badami

Badami, located about 140 km from Hampi, is a historic town famous for its stunning rock-cut temples and ancient caves.

Some of the top attractions in Badami include:

  • The Badami Cave Temples, which date back to the 6th century AD.
  • The Badami Fort, which offers stunning views of the surrounding landscape.
  • The Agastya Lake, a scenic spot for boating and relaxation.

Aihole

Aihole, located about 110 km from Hampi, is a historic town famous for its ancient temples and sculptures.

Some of the top attractions in Aihole include:

  • The Aihole Temple Complex, which features over 100 ancient temples.
  • The Durga Temple, which is one of the most famous temples in Aihole.
  • The Lad Khan Temple, which is a beautiful example of ancient Indian architecture.

How far is Hospet from Hampi, and what are the transportation options?

Hospet is approximately 13 km from Hampi and is the nearest town with a railway station. You can hire autos, taxis, or buses to travel from Hospet to Hampi. The journey takes around 30-40 minutes, depending on the traffic. You can also rent bicycles or motorcycles for a more adventurous ride.

Are there any adventure activities available near Hampi?

Yes, Hampi and its surroundings offer a range of adventure activities for thrill-seekers. You can go rock climbing, bouldering, or trekking in the rugged terrain of Hampi. You can also try coracle riding or take a boat ride on the Tungabhadra River. For a more relaxing experience, you can try yoga or meditation in the serene surroundings of Hampi.
